Construction and Project Management Services, Construction Project Management Services for Efficient Delivery and Cost Control

Construction and project management services play a crucial role in guiding construction projects from initial design through to final delivery. These services involve meticulous planning, coordination, and oversight to align all activities, budgets, and teams with the client’s goals. Effective construction project management ensures that projects are completed on time, within budget, and meet the necessary quality standards.

Construction managers differ from general contractors by focusing on the overall project strategy rather than just the execution of specific tasks. They provide expertise in scheduling, cost control, quality assurance, and safety management, often offering both onsite and remote supervision. This holistic approach helps prevent delays, cost overruns, and quality issues during complex developments.

By integrating technical knowledge with practical oversight, construction project management services support every phase of a build. Their involvement maximizes efficiency and minimizes risk, delivering value to owners and contractors alike throughout the project lifecycle.

Core Principles of Construction Project Management

Construction Project Management Services rely on principles of planning, scheduling, budgeting, quality control, and risk management. Effective planning outlines scope, timelines, and resource needs to guide the project successfully.

Scheduling breaks down tasks into manageable phases while tracking progress against deadlines. Budget management controls costs to prevent overruns and ensure financial discipline.

Quality control establishes standards and inspections to meet required specifications. Risk management identifies potential issues early and develops mitigation strategies to minimize impacts.

Together, these principles provide a framework for disciplined execution and successful project delivery within predefined constraints.

Types of Construction Project Management Services

Construction project management services can vary but typically include:

  • Pre-construction planning: Feasibility studies, design coordination, estimating.
  • Project scheduling and budgeting: Developing timelines and cost plans.
  • Procurement management: Sourcing and purchasing materials and equipment.
  • On-site supervision: Daily oversight of construction activities and safety.
  • Quality assurance and control: Inspections and compliance verification.
  • Risk and change management: Addressing unforeseen issues and adjustments.

Each service focuses on specific phases or challenges within a project, collectively covering all stages from conception through completion.

Key Stakeholders and Roles

Key stakeholders include the ownerconstruction managerproject manager, contractors, engineers, and architects. The owner sets objectives and provides funding.

The construction manager oversees on-site operations, focusing on execution, safety, and compliance. The project manager handles overall coordination, scheduling, and communication between parties.

Contractors perform physical construction work, while engineers and architects develop and validate project designs and technical specifications.

Strong collaboration and clear responsibilities among these roles are essential to align efforts and meet project goals effectively.

Benefits and Industry Applications

Construction project management services focus on optimizing resources, controlling costs, and maintaining schedules to deliver projects successfully. These services apply across various industry sectors and incorporate strategies to manage risks effectively.

Efficiency and Cost Savings

Construction project management improves efficiency by streamlining planning, scheduling, and resource allocation. Using specialized software, teams achieve better communication and collaboration, reducing delays and errors on-site.

Effective cost management is a key benefit. Monitoring budgets closely prevents cost overruns and maximizes return on investment. This includes forecasting expenses and adjusting plans proactively to stay within financial targets.

Enhanced visibility into project progress helps managers identify issues early, enabling timely interventions. These measures collectively reduce waste, lower labor costs, and improve overall project profitability.

Industry Sectors Utilized

Construction project management services are utilized in sectors including commercial, residential, infrastructure, and industrial construction. Each sector demands tailored approaches based on project scale, complexity, and regulatory requirements.

Infrastructure projects, such as roadways and bridges, depend heavily on stringent project management due to their public safety implications and extended timelines. Commercial projects often focus on balancing speed with quality to meet market demands.

Residential construction management prioritizes customer communication and budget control. Industrial projects emphasize compliance with technical standards and risk mitigation. Across all sectors, structured project management enhances project delivery and stakeholder satisfaction.

Risk Management Strategies

Risk management in construction involves identifying, assessing, and controlling potential threats to project success. These risks can include budget overruns, safety hazards, regulatory compliance issues, and environmental factors.

Project managers implement strategies such as contingency planning, regular risk assessments, and safety protocols. Continuous monitoring and communication ensure early detection of risks and timely mitigation actions.

Using data-driven tools, managers analyze project variables to predict risks and allocate resources accordingly. This proactive approach reduces disruptions and supports safer working conditions, contributing to more consistent project outcomes.
